This was a surprising read that i really enjoyed way more than anticipated and i just love when that happens. This story follows 4 couples in a small town and an unfortunate event involving a child happens and we as the reader are trying to determine what led to such a tragic accident and all involved and we learn about the lives of these couples and their connections and relationships all while trying to determine if it was indeed an accident at all? This is my first Ashley Audrain book but i can def say i look forward to what she writes next and while certainly pick it up especially if she veers away from child/parent theme being so prominent and focuses more on other human connections and experiences as that's just my personal taste because the way she handled these hard hitting, real taboo themes was intriguing and entertaining as hell to read. She really goes there and does not shy away from the more immoral and negative sides of people that can come out when we are navigating different types of relationships. Her first book push i knew was heavily focused on a strained mother/daughter dynamic and i was not interested so i didn't pick it up but i knew this book while it does center around another child/parent them it also included themes around romantic and adult friendship relationships within a small town which piqued my interest and i was not disappointed. She writes well and really does not shy away from the more immoral and taboo traits and attributes that adults can possess when encountering each other in romantic and platonic settings and it was great to read even appalling at times in the best way. I will say someone noted that this book makes you never want to get married or have children and i that is such an accurate statement LMAO everyone in this book are depicted to be quite complex and down right deplorable at points and its quite entertaining and makes you shake your head and the author again does not shy away from those negative traits. That said this may not be everyone's cup of tea and i def encourage looking up trigger warnings before diving into this especially if you know u don't like reading about certain topics involving children, child neglect, fertility issues, infidelity, child death, unlikable characters etc. I for one enjoyed this and the ending was great as well!! i chuckled and felt the pacing and how we wrapped up the mystery element was well done.
